Sheffield Wednesday Blow As Two Players Are Set To Miss Clash Vs Leeds United

Leeds United will resume their Championship promotion charge on Sunday when they welcome Yorkshire neighbours Sheffield Wednesday to Elland Road.

Given the Whites have not lost on home soil since mid-September, Daniel Farke’s men will fancy their chances of claiming the local bragging rights. They triumphed in the reverse fixture after goals either side of half-time from Brenden Aaronson and Daniel James.

But the Owls have got their eyes sight firmly on securing a top-six finish. They are currently in 10th position, three points outside of the play-offs after a mixed festive period.

Wednesday coach Danny Röhl will definitely be without the services of Dominic Iorfa. The centre-back suffered a muscular injury in their recent home draw with Millwall. Iorfa is not expected to return to action until March.

Centre-half is an area where the Owls are thin on options as Akin Famewo is also a long-term absentee. Full-backs Yan Valery and Max Lowe have frequently lined up in Röhl’s three-man defence.

Röhl is optimistic wing back Marvin Johnson will be available for selection. The left-sided player has not figured in their past matches due to a muscle problem sustained in the New Year’s Day win over Derby County.

Wednesday enter the clash on the back of losing to Coventry City on penalties in the FA Cup. “It’s hard to take as a team to lose this way,” said Röhl. “It was a strong performance. We had good opportunities. We were always in the game. But we could not find the final pass

“We have a belief. We never give up. We go for 120 minutes. We wanted to win. Set-pieces have cost us a lot of games and it has happened again to us.”
